Men’s Volleyball Splits Sunday Games

NEW PALTZ — The New Paltz men’s volleyball team split games against D’Youville and NYU Saturday at Elting Gym to bring their season record to 7-8.

In the first match, the Hawks blew past the visiting Spartans of D’Youville in three straight games 30-22, 30- 26, and 30-26. Jim Cramer (New Oxford, PA) led a balanced New Paltz attack with a double-double finishing with 10 kills, and 11 assists. In total the Hawks had six players with at least 6 kills and five players with at least 6 digs.

In the Hawks’ second match of the day against NYU, the Violets cruised to victory in three straight games 30-13, 30-21, 30-23. Mike La Rocco (Hauppauge, NY) had 7 kills and Beau Warren (Canandaigua, NY) had 21 assists in the match.

New Paltz will next travel to MIT and Harvard next Saturday for afternoon matches.
